 <title>Meet the nano-spiders</title>
 <link>http://www.freetalklive.com/content/meet_nano_spiders</link>
 <description>&lt;p&gt;Scientists have created microscopic robots out of DNA molecules that can walk, turn and even create tiny products of their own on a nano-scale assembly line.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;The ground-breaking devices outlined in the journal Nature, could one day lead to armies of surgeon robots that could clean human arteries or build computer components.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;In one of the projects a team from New York&#039;s Columbia University created a spider bot just four nanometres across. This is about 100,000 times smaller than the diameter of a human hair.&lt;/p&gt;

 <title>Oops! Himalayan Glaciers Won&#039;t Vanish by 2035</title>
 <link>http://www.freetalklive.com/content/oops_himalayan_glaciers_wont_vanish_2035</link>
 <description>&lt;p&gt;Leaders of the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change (IPCC) expressed regret over a report that predicted Himalayan glaciers would disappear by 2035. The report had stated: &quot;Glaciers in the Himalaya are receding faster than in any other part of the world and, if the present rate continues, the likelihood of them disappearing by the year 2035 and perhaps sooner is very high if the Earth keeps warming at the current rate.&quot; The statement was exaggerated, the officials now say.&lt;/p&gt;
